on a tight budget

UK/ɒn ə taɪt ˈbʌdʒɪt/US/ɑn ə taɪt ˈbʌdʒɪt/on a TIGHT BUD·get

Band 5-6speakingtask2

having only a small amount of money to spend

Examples

As a student I live on a tight budget, so I cook at home most nights.

We wanted to go on holiday but we were on a tight budget.

When you're on a tight budget, it's smart to plan meals in advance.

Band 8 sentence

During my first year at university I was on a tight budget, so I learned to cook simple meals and avoid eating out.
